Discover Cape Town, Kruger and Karongwe wildlife, and Victoria Falls on an upgraded National Geographic Journeys small-group adventure with cultural highlights and included internal flights.
-
Explore Kirstenbosch National Botanical Garden with an expert guide.
-
Visit Cape Point and see African penguins at Boulders Beach.
-
Tour Soweto township and the Mandela House Museum.
-
Drive the Panorama Route: Blyde River Canyon and God's Window.
-
Spot big game on a full-day Kruger National Park safari.
-
Learn about cheetah conservation on a Karongwe researcher-led game drive.
-
Share a home-cooked meal with a Zimbabwean family near Victoria Falls.
-
Walk rainforest trails beside thundering Victoria Falls.

The tented camp accommodations on this tour are situated centrally, with easy access to the park for wildlife safari drives. Tents are typically spacious with mosquito-proof netting, comfortable bedding, and en-suite bathroom with flushing toilets and camping showers.
Please remember that hotel/lodge/camp standards can be different from what you are used to in your home country, which is part of the appeal of adventure travel.
Note:
1) Under certain circumstances, we reserve the right to change accommodation and provide something slightly different to what is described, though it will always be of similar or better standard/level.
2) Most lodges and camps do not have 24hr electricity - they usually run on generators which are routinely shut off overnight from approximately 10pm to 5am.
3) Lodges and camps are NOT equipped with fans or air conditioning due to the electricity constraints listed above.
4) Winter nights (June to September) can be cold, and most lodges and hotels do not have insulation or central heating. If you require additional blankets or a hot water bottle, these can be requested through your Expedition Leader or at the reception.
